Lenovo's U1 hybrid Pad is definitely not your typical computer tablet. With its cool design one can be sure it is one of the lightest computers around, but just get a load of its other features. The U1 comes with a keyboard that you attach your tablet with and in a second, its screen will change and suddenly you now have a laptop feel from the tablet which is what we users have always been used to.
